Payroll Year End

Posted in Sage Software

As the Payroll Year End moves closer it is important that you start preparing for it. To help you with your preparation in this week’s blog entry we have included some information on submissions and important dates for you to keep in mind.

  • Are you aware that all employers with 50 or more employees must submit their Year End returns online?
  • Employees that have fewer than 50 employees needn’t submit online until 2010, but if you do you could benefit from a £75 incentive from HMRC this year!

If you haven’t submitted online before register at http://online.hmrc.gov.uk

Dates for you to remember:

  • 6th April- Start of 2009/2010 Tax Year.
  • 19th April- Manual payments of PAYE and NI deductions for the final tax month or quarter must be received by HMRC. Electronic payments must be received by 22nd April.
  • 1st May- Spring budget, details of any parameter changes required should have reached you.
  • 19th May- Your Year End returns must be received by HMRC.
